Understanding the Legal Landscape of Cannabis in Jakarta
Understanding Jakarta’s cannabis laws is very important. Other Southeast Asian countries have changed their rules. But Indonesia still has strict rules against drugs. Here’s what you need to know before you do anything with cannabis.
The Current Status of Cannabis Laws
In Indonesia, cannabis is seen as a very bad drug. No one is allowed to use it for fun, in religious events, or to grow it at home. Last year, police found and took away a lot of cannabis, showing they are very serious about this.
Consequences of Cannabis Possession
Even a little bit of cannabis can get you into big trouble. The law says you must go to jail for at least 4 years. If you have more, the punishment gets even worse.
For example, Fidelis Arie got 8 months in jail, even though he said he needed it for health reasons.
How long you’ll be in jail depends on how much you have:
| Amount | Minimum Sentence | Maximum Fine |
|---|---|---|
| Under 1kg | 4 years | Rp 1B ($65,000) |
| 1-5kg | 5 years | Rp 8B ($520,000) |
| Over 5kg | Life imprisonment | Rp 10B+ ($650,000+) |
Recent Legislative Changes
Thailand made medical cannabis legal in 2022, but Indonesia hasn’t changed its rules. In 2023, there were talks about using cannabis for health, but nothing happened. Police still do razia (raids) in Jakarta every week.

Social and Cultural Perceptions of Cannabis
Jakarta has a special bond with cannabis. Laws say it’s bad, but people talk about it in secret. In Aceh, they’ve been drinking cannabis coffee for ages. This shows how old traditions can change our views.

Attitudes Toward Cannabis Use
In Jakarta, people’s views on cannabis change a lot. Older folks see it as bad, linked to crime. But younger people talk about its good sides, in secret or in art places.
Lawmakers are debating if to make medical cannabis legal. Social media is full of jokes about Indonesia’s strict rules. Young people in cities feel this divide a lot, where new ideas meet old rules.
Cannabis in Local Arts and Media
In Jakarta, artists and musicians hint at cannabis in their work. They use it to show rebellion. But TV and newspapers mostly report on arrests.
On Instagram, #JakartaWeedCulture shows a hidden world. Artists post pictures of cannabis, and bloggers write about its history. It’s a secret celebration of cannabis, hidden from the law.
